JUANITA STOUT
Mrs. Juanita (Pickering)Stout, 75-year-old former resident of Siloam Springs, died Saturday, October 14, in the Heights Hospital at Houston, Tex. after an extended illness.
Mrs. Stout was born February 19, 1903, in Louisiana, the daughter of E.C. and Clementine Pickering. She was a member of the Grace Methodist Church at Houston.
She is survived by: her husband, Newton of Houston, Tex.
Graveside rites were held at 2 p.m. Tuesday, October 17, in the Oak Hill Cemetery.
Arrangements were under the direction of the Pyeatte Funeral Service.
